Q: Is 630,876 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 630,876 is a composite number.

Why is 630,876 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 630,876 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 19 38 57 76 114 228 2,767 5,534 8,301 11,068 16,602 33,204 52,573 105,146 157,719 210,292 315,438 and 630,876, with no remainder.

Since 630,876 cannot be divided by just 1 and 630,876, it is a composite number.
